About Nitin Ohri
Nitin Ohri is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Radiation and Hepatology, having authored 144 papers that have together received 3.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(22 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(15 papers),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(13 papers), Cancer Immunotherapy and Biomarkers (13 papers), Hepatocellular Carcinoma Treatment and Prognosis (12 papers), Cancer survivorship and care (10 papers), Head and Neck Cancer Studies (10 papers) and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Radiation (363 citations), Oncology (876 citations), Hepatology (244 citations), Otorhinolaryngology (125 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(837 citations). Nitin Ohri has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Timothy N. Showalter, Adam P. Dicker, Madhur Garg, Shalom Kalnicki, Chandan Guha, Rafi Kabarriti, Balázs Halmos, Wolfgang A. Tomé, Maria Werner‐Wasik and Xinglei Shen.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ics, Journal of Clinical Oncology, Advances in Radiation Oncology, Clinical Lung Cancer and Practical Radiation Oncology.
